Participate in a Training Course

A motorcycle ride is an exciting experience and is an economical way to get around. Learn a course before you venture out with your bike. This will not only prepare you for your road test but could also speed up the process of getting your license. Many insurers also offer discounts to those who attend a safety class.

The Motorcycle Operator's Manual is the first step in obtaining a motorcycle license. The manual contains the necessary information to pass the written exam. The test consists of multiple-choice questions on motorcycle safety and laws. It can be found on the internet or at your local DMV office.

After reading the manual, füHrerschein kaufen erfahrungen you should schedule an appointment at your local DMV office to take the written test. The test will be based on the information in the manual, and will include multiple-choice questions and true/false ones. To pass the test, you must score at least 70 percent..

Once you have successfully passed the written exam after which you can make an appointment to take your road skills test. The test varies by state, but it will most likely involve performing maneuvers such as left and right circles as well as figures-eights on streets that are public. Practice these maneuvers prior to going to the DMV. This will help you feel more confident on the day of the test.

If you want to save some time and money, you can enroll in a basic rider course from the MSF (Motorcycle Safety Foundation). These courses will prepare you for Module 1 and Module 2 tests. Module 1 is a motorcycle off-road test that is designed to test your handling and control of the bike. Module 2 is similar to a road test, and requires riding in different conditions.

Try a Road Test

Before you can drive your new motorbike on the road, you have to pass a skills test. You will be required to ride your bike in both left and right circular motions as well as to make figures of eights on a public roadway. You will also have to show that you can stop or swerve, accelerate, and turn without losing control of your bike. After lots of practice, it is recommended that you only take the test. To prepare you for the test, you must read the Motorcycle Operator's Manual of your state, which is available on the internet and at your local department of motor vehicles (DMV).
